Multi-language Ecommerce Store by Abdelsalam ShahlolMulti-language Ecommerce Store by Abdelsalam Shahlol

Multi-language Ecommerce Store

Abdelsalam Shahlol

Abdelsalam Shahlol

I developed the complete Frontend of a multilingual e-commerce platform using Nuxt.js, implementing hybrid rendering to optimize both server-side and client-side performance. The UI was built using TailwindCSS based on Figma mockups, ensuring an intuitive user experience for both Arabic (RTL) and English (LTR) users.

Key Features

Responsive UI: Leveraged TailwindCSS for consistent, responsive design across devices, maintaining clean and scalable code.
Multilingual Support: Seamlessly integrated support for both right-to-left (Arabic) and left-to-right (English) languages, enhancing accessibility.
Social Login: Implemented secure, easy authentication via Firebase, allowing users to register and log in with their Google accounts.
Powerful Search: Integrated Algolia search for real-time, high-speed product filtering, ensuring users can quickly find what they need.
Filtering System: Developed a dynamic filter and sorting feature for product search, with custom options like price, brand, and technical specifications.
Home page
Home page
Product page
Product page
Product page (Mobile)
Product page (Mobile)
Explore page
Explore page
Login / Signup page
Login / Signup page
Advanced search and filtering
Advanced search and filtering
Explore page (Arabic)
Explore page (Arabic)
Login / Signup (Arabic)
Login / Signup (Arabic)
Like this project

Posted Sep 8, 2024

A multilingual e-commerce platform built with Nuxt, featuring responsive design with TailwindCSS, social login, and Algolia-powered search.